1,3-Alternate 25,27-dibenzoiloxy-26,28-bis-[3-propyloxy]-calix[4]arene-bonded silica gel as a new type of HPLC stationary phase
Authors:Sliwka-Kaszyńska Magdalena  Jaszczo?t Katarzyna  Ko?odziejczyk Aleksander  Rachoń Janusz
Institution:

Department of Organic Chemistry, Gdansk University of Technology, Narutowicza 11/12, 80-952 Gdańsk, Poland

Abstract:A new 1,3-alternate 25,27-dibenzoiloxy-26,28-bis-3-propyloxy]-calix4]arene-bonded silica gel stationary phase (1,3-Alt CalixBn) has been prepared and used for the separation of aromatic positional isomers by high-performance liquid chromatography (HPLC). The effect of organic modifier content and pH of the mobile phase on retention and selectivity of these compounds were studied. Application examples were provided for separation of purine and pyrimidine bases and non-steroidal anti-inflammatory drugs.
